Title

INVESTIGATION OF VALIDITY AND RELIABILITY OF PERSIAN VERSION OF THE "ST. GEORGE RESPIRATORY QUESTIONAIRE"

Pages

  43-50

Abstract

 Background: Health related quality of life (HRQL) questionnaires allow clinicians to measure daily the impact of disease on a patient's daily life and is valuable in clinical trial designed to assess benefits and costs of management. We describe the adaptation into PERSIAN VERSION of the St.George Respiratory Questionnaires (SGRQ); a recognized valid self administered questionnaire for chronic obstructive pulmonary diseases. Materials and Methods: In order to adapt the face VALIDITY, the forward and back- translation method was used. Then this questionnaire was edited by researchers and a single pulmonologist as an internist. The content of tests evaluated for feasibility and comprehension by 15 educated COPD patients. In following, the professional committee of researcher assessed the content VALIDITY. At last, 55 COPD patients with wide range of disease severity fulfilled the PERSIAN VERSION of the SGRQ. Internal consistency was measured by Cronbach's alpha coefficient test. Results: The test co efficiency for RELIABILITy was 0.74 in part I of questionnaire; "symptoms". Factor analysis indicated that if latest question of part 1 was eliminated ["If you wheeze, is it become worse in the morning?"] Cronbach's alpha would be elevated to 0.78. Cronbach's alpha was 0.95 in Part II (Activity & impact) and for overall scale, the result was found to be 0.93. Conclusion: Data from this study revealed that PERSIAN VERSION of SGRQ, as a research tool, is of good VALIDITY and sufficient RELIABILITy. The present study suggest the feasibility of adapting a specific instrument of health related quality of life in patients with respiratory disease to be used in different settings from where the instrument has been originally developed.
